How the estimate works

Depth is only the first number

The range is calculated from government well records or depth guidance and the ground conditions commonly encountered in the area. It is not a published government price and it cannot predict whether a specific bore will be dry, unusually deep or difficult to reach.

Ask every bidder for one complete-system total. It should identify drilling, casing, grouting, pump, pressure tank, electrical work, permit or filing charges, water testing and restoration separately.

Local cost drivers

Why California quotes vary by area

Central Valley

Alluvial sand and gravel can drill faster, but casing and water-level conditions still vary by parcel.

Usually lower drilling resistance

Coastal basins

Layered sediments and local groundwater rules make county records especially important.

Site-specific

Sierra foothills and mountain areas

Granite and fractured rock can slow drilling and increase the per-foot rate.

Higher hard-rock risk
Licensing check

Verify the people doing the work

Hire a California contractor with the CSLB C-57 Well Drilling classification and confirm that the licence is active for the company named on the quote.

Before drilling

Confirm the permit path

Well permits and setback reviews are commonly handled locally. The driller should confirm the county environmental-health process and file the required well-completion report.

After construction

Test the water before choosing treatment

Plan laboratory testing after construction. The State Water Board publishes private domestic-well testing guidance; the right panel depends on local land use and geology.

Quote checklist

Compare the same scope—not just the headline price

  1. Licence and insurance: match the name on the proposal to the current public record.
  2. Depth and per-foot terms: record the included depth, overage rate and dry-hole terms.
  3. Complete system: separate drilling, casing, grout, pump, tank, wiring, permit, test and restoration.
  4. Water and workmanship: ask about yield testing, disinfection, laboratory testing and written warranties.

How deep is a residential well in California?

The reference point used here is about 274 ft. A nearby completion record is more useful than a broad average, and only drilling confirms the final depth and yield.

Do I need a licensed well driller or a permit in California?

Hire a California contractor with the CSLB C-57 Well Drilling classification and confirm that the licence is active for the company named on the quote. Well permits and setback reviews are commonly handled locally. The driller should confirm the county environmental-health process and file the required well-completion report.

What should a complete well quote include?

Compare drilling, casing, grout, pump, pressure tank, electrical work, permit or filing fees, yield testing, disinfection, laboratory testing, restoration, over-depth pricing and dry-hole terms on separate lines.
